The authors present VJHK observations of the metal-poor field RR Lyrae star VY Serpentis. Using a variation of the Baade-Wesselink method they derive a radius of 5.80±0.19 R_sun; at minimum light. The use of infrared magnitudes and colours results in a consistent set of radius determinations. For a temperature at minimum light of 6000±150K then MV(min) = 0.90±0.12 mag and
